| # IMPORTANT for older GPUs: the default wheel on PyPI is now a cu130 build, and | |
| # cu130 dropped Volta (sm_70). On a V100 it fails at the first kernel launch | |
| # with "no kernel image is available for execution on the device" - after | |
| # torch.cuda.is_available() has already returned True. For sm_70 install a cu128 | |
| # build instead: | |
| # pip install torch --index-url https://download.pytorch.org/whl/cu128 | |
